碯 · nǎo
Agate — a type of chalcedony quartz with colored bands or patterns, used as a gemstone and in decorative objects.

Usage & contexts
Examples
- This bracelet is made of agate (玛瑙).
- The mineral specimen shows beautiful agate banding (玛瑙纹).
- Agate is often used in carvings and jewelry (玛瑙雕刻).
Collocations
- Agate(玛瑙)
- Red agate(红玛瑙)
- Agate carving(玛瑙雕)
- Agate bracelet(玛瑙手镯)
- Striped agate(条纹玛瑙)
- Agate stone(玛瑙石)

Cultural background
FAQ- Agate has been valued in Chinese culture for centuries as a precious stone with protective qualities.
- In traditional Chinese medicine, agate was believed to have calming and balancing properties.
- Agate artifacts have been found in archaeological sites dating back to ancient Chinese dynasties.
